#e13634 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e13634 is composed of 88.2% red, 21.2%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76% magenta, 76.9%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 0.7 degrees, a saturation of 74.2% and a lightness of 54.3%. #e13634 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6c68 with #c30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#e13634 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e13634 has RGB values of R:225, G:54,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.77,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14759476.

Shades and Tints of #e13634
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020000 is the darkest color, while #fdf0f0 is the lightest one.
